02-22-2012, 02:29 PM
Still have not seen an official schedule, but believe this is correct. If so, ~1,200 miles of travel - not even close to the 1,900 for Monahans:

Week 0: @ Argyle
Week 1: Bridgeport
Week 2: Graham
Week 3: @ Brownwood
Week 4: Lubbock Estacado
Week 5: Open
Week 6: @ Big Spring
Week 7: Monahans
Week 8: @ Midland Greenwood
Week 9: @ Snyder
Week 10: Sweetwater
